ok so lets start with a bit backstory of how polhun relationship looked like in ww2 from a historical side:
to put it in simplest terms and without all the non-fiction jargon i have to translate to myself: despite being on the opposite sides of the war, hungary helped out polish people immensely; housing, protecting, helping with passport over a 100 thousand people, along with supplying soldiers with ammo and weapons
so yeah keep in mind that hungary helped poland out a fuckton during the war, while on the opposite sides (sic!) and didnt expect much in reperations and shit.
now lets go into a timeline a bit: two important bits of info is that theres first establishing diplomatic relations and then giving an embassy title.
poland established diplomatic relations with countries like yugoslavia, czechoslovakia, bulgaria and romania from around march to august of 1945 (with romania immediately gaining an embassy title!)
poland didnt establish diplomatic relations with hungary until the end of december 1945. and its not until march 1946 until they like Actually established diplomatic relations. and hungary didnt get a polish embassy until almost 10 years later (1954).
so lets compare in months: the first diplomatic relations with any country were first established in march 1945, and bar hungary the latest one was in august same year. meaning not only there was a seven month gap between relations establishment between romania and hungary, it wasnt until a year later since poland started establishing diplomatic relations, that they did so with hungary, their best friend, their brother.
whats also interesting is that there was little to no coverage about hungary in polish press. its all really weird fucking already but wait until we get into the peace conference of paris, then ill tell yall what was actually up.
so the peace conference in paris started on july 29th, 1946 (funfact gdr wouldnt be established until 1949, for anyone curious). hungary was in a tough spot politically, not only as the losing side of the entire war, but also that their whole shtick was (as far as im aware) to get back the land that they lost of the treaty of trianon, so to oversimplify it: its border drama time. they needed all the support they could get, and since most of their neighbours didnt fucking like them, they hoped to get that support from poland. yknow their brother their best friend, that fucker they helped in the war even it could get them fucked over- ya get the gist

Not Only Did Poland Offer No Help With The Borders. They Agreed With Czechoslovakia On That Which Wasnt What Hungary Hoped For. They Demanded 20 Fucking Million Dollars Of Reparations. From Hungary.
Let That Sink In.
And you know on what basis? on apparent damages and aggressions that were made by the hungarian army.
as you can probably tell, everyone was baffled at the fucking audacity. polish claims extremely soured the opinion of hungarian folks about poland, the westies were also against it, and the polish charge d'affaires piotr szymański (who apparently doesnt fucking exist on the internet! fucking weird) had to do an interview where he tried to explain the demand for reparations.

because soviets were already balls deep into the polish government by the time 1945 rolled around, every decision had to be backed up by the soviet approval. and it took them a while until they approved establishing the pol-hun diplomatic relations.
and! the soviets were the ones who pushed the polish diplomats to demand the 20 million dollars! and they knew that it would fuck up the relations. one of the diplomats at the conference in their diary wrote that the soviets wanted to ruin polish-hungarian diplomatic relations, they succeeded.
then there was also a fuckton of arguing and political bickering about the objects moved out of poland that after the war ended up in hungary, one of them being a cooling machine that was crucial to mining coal - aka, an overglorified refrigirator. at some point polish side didnt even want all the objects back because they were in horrible condition, they just wanted the money for them.
obviously all of this didnt destroy the polish-hungarian relations forever because c'mon we're better than that, but it was described as the worst time in the history of the nations' friendship. which in of itself is pretty telling if some petty manipulated arguments were the rockiest patch in their friendship.
tldr; ussr with the grip over poland and slowly tightening grip on hungary tried to sabotage their friendship by making polish ambassadors demand 20 million dollars in reparations from hungary, when not only hungary didnt actively try to do any damage, they helped a fuckton of polish people throughout the entire war. other political shenanigans ensue.
